About
Elevated Wealth provides comprehensive wealth management and financial planning to individuals, high‑net‑worth clients, trusts, estates, and small business entities. Services include ongoing discretionary portfolio management, project‑based and ongoing financial planning, retirement and tax planning, college savings, estate planning support, and recommendations of third‑party money managers and other professionals.
The firm combines fundamental and technical analysis, mutual fund/ETF evaluation, and asset‑allocation work to tailor portfolios across passive and active strategies to clients’ risk tolerances and goals. Operating as a fiduciary and a fee‑only adviser, it typically manages accounts on a discretionary basis while permitting reasonable client‑imposed restrictions, conducts at least annual reviews, and provides ongoing access to a planner for implementation and monitoring.
Distinctive features noted in the brochure include in‑depth planning capabilities for matters such as non‑qualified deferred compensation, employee benefits optimization, and business planning, and a stated practice of participating in meetings with clients’ tax or legal advisors. The firm also highlights use of institutional custody platforms (including relationships with Charles Schwab and Altruist) for trading and back‑office support and may waive standalone planning fees when clients engage its asset management services.
